Working up my first load here. It’s for a .243 Ruger American gen 2. Using sierra pro hunter 100gr bullets, Remington brass, cci 200 primers, and H4350 powder. I don’t have a chronograph. I shot 4 shots with each of these powder charges at 100yds and here are the group sizes of each powder.
Where would you guys go from here/next step? Shoot a couple groups of 37.5 and 40grains to see if the results repeat themselves?

4 shots is not enough. You don't need to do 20 if you literally don't have the time or ammo, but depending on what your goal is you should at least 10 shot groups (I think that gives you like a 90+% chance of getting a true picture of your rifle's dispersion) with each load before you draw any conclusions.
